The places of the Heidelberg Christmas Market
Bismarckplatz:
As the entrance to the old town, Bismarckplatz with its pre-Christmas flair sets the mood for an unforgettable visit to the Christmas Market.
Anatomiegarten:
In front of the monument for chemist Robert Bunsen festively decorated huts invite for a visit.
Universitätsplatz:
You will find everything that makes you happy on the largest square of the Heidelberg Christmas Market. While the little ones have fun on the antique carousel, the parents treat themselves to a little break from the hustle and bustle with mulled wine and bratwurst.
Kornmarkt:
Illuminated fir trees and illuminated pointed tents create an atmospheric atmosphere.
Karlsplatz:
Framed by the romantic castle backdrop, one of the most beautiful ice rinks in Germany. Further information can be found here.
Marktplatz:
The highlight of the square is the Heidelberg barrel. A large wooden barrel with a capacity of 120,000 liters. This makes it about half the size of the original, namely the large barrel in Heidelberg Castle. Inside the barrel, there is a room above the sales booth with a wonderful view of the box overlooking the market. Santa's House on the Market Square
Experience Father Christmas live in Heidelberg!
For a minimum donation of € 8.00, visitors young and old can visit Santa and take a photo or video via smartphone.
The Lions Club Heidelberg-Altstadt uses the donations to support Heidelberg children's projects.
